From its distinctive neighborhoods to its architectural homes, Los Angeles has been the backdrop to countless movies. In this dazzling work, Andersen takes viewers on a whirlwind tour through the metropolis' real and cinematic history, investigating the myriad stories and legends that have come to define it, and meticulously, judiciously revealing the real city that lives beneath.
Released in 2004, Los Angeles Plays Itself is a documentary and history film from Thom Andersen Productions (United States of America). It was directed by Thom Andersen and written by Thom Andersen. The cast is led by Encke King. With a runtime of 2h 49m, the film averages 7.6/10 across 69 TMDB ratings.
